    Understanding Experiential Learning

    Experiential learning is an approach in which students actively participate in experiences that are directly related to the subject matter. Unlike traditional learning, which often prioritizes passive absorption of information, experiential learning emphasizes action, reflection, and practical application. It allows students to engage with material in a meaningful way, often by solving real-world problems, conducting experiments, or participating in collaborative projects.

    This learning model is rooted in the belief that knowledge is constructed through experience. By actively engaging with content, students internalize concepts more effectively and are better prepared to apply them in various contexts. Experiential learning not only enhances understanding but also fosters essential soft skills such as collaboration, communication, and decision-making.

    The Benefits of Experiential Learning

    One of the primary advantages of experiential learning is its ability to enhance retention and understanding. When students interact with content through projects, simulations, or real-life applications, they are more likely to remember what they learn and comprehend it at a deeper level. This contrasts sharply with rote memorization, which may help students pass exams but often leaves them unable to apply knowledge outside the classroom.

    Experiential learning also encourages critical thinking. Students are often presented with complex, open-ended challenges that require them to analyze information, evaluate alternatives, and develop solutions. This process strengthens problem-solving abilities and prepares learners to face uncertainty and ambiguity in both academic and professional contexts.

    Furthermore, experiential learning nurtures creativity and innovation. By exploring multiple solutions to a problem and experimenting with ideas, students develop the confidence to think outside the box. These skills are highly valued in modern workplaces, where adaptability and ingenuity are essential for success.

    Methods of Implementing Experiential Learning

    There are various methods through which experiential learning can be integrated into education. Project-based learning is one of the most common approaches. In this model, students work on a project over an extended period, often incorporating research, collaboration, and practical application of knowledge. For example, a science class might design and execute a small-scale sustainability project, analyzing data and proposing solutions for local environmental issues.

    Internships and work-based learning are another effective method. By working in professional environments related to their field of study, students gain firsthand experience that bridges the gap between theory and practice. These experiences not only reinforce classroom learning but also expose students to workplace dynamics, expectations, and challenges.

    Service learning, where students engage in community-based projects, provides yet another dimension. By participating in initiatives that address societal needs, learners develop empathy, social responsibility, and leadership skills, all while applying academic knowledge in meaningful contexts.

    The Role of Reflection in Experiential Learning

    Reflection is a critical component of experiential learning. It is not enough for students to simply participate in an activity; they must also reflect on their experiences to extract lessons and insights. Reflection helps learners understand the connection between theory and practice, recognize their strengths and weaknesses, and develop strategies for improvement.

    Teachers can facilitate reflection through guided discussions, journals, and self-assessment exercises. By encouraging students to articulate what they learned, what challenges they faced, and how they overcame obstacles, educators foster a deeper understanding and reinforce the value of experiential learning.

    Technology and Experiential Learning

    Technology plays an increasingly important role in facilitating experiential learning. Virtual simulations, online collaboration tools, and interactive platforms allow students to engage in immersive experiences even outside the physical classroom. For instance, virtual laboratories can enable science students to conduct experiments safely and efficiently, while online project management tools can help students coordinate team-based assignments.

    Digital technologies also provide opportunities for personalized learning. Adaptive software can offer challenges tailored to each student’s skill level, ensuring that learners remain engaged and motivated. By combining technology with hands-on experiences, educators can create dynamic learning environments that maximize engagement, understanding, and skill development.

    Challenges in Adopting Experiential Learning

    Despite its benefits, integrating experiential learning into traditional education systems presents challenges. One significant obstacle is the pressure to meet standardized testing benchmarks. Schools often prioritize measurable academic outcomes over experiential activities, which can make it difficult to allocate time and resources for hands-on projects.

    Another challenge is ensuring equitable access to experiential opportunities. Not all students have the same resources, community connections, or technological access required for certain projects or internships. Addressing these disparities requires careful planning, funding, and support from educational institutions.

    Teachers may also face professional development needs, as experiential learning requires new instructional strategies, assessment methods, and classroom management skills. Providing educators with adequate training and resources is essential for successful implementation.

    Understanding How Online Casinos Operate

    Online casinos function on mathematical models. Every game—whether it is slots, blackjack, roulette, or baccarat—operates using algorithms known as Random Number Generators (RNGs). These systems ensure outcomes are unpredictable and not influenced by previous results.

    Each game also has a built-in concept known as the house edge. The house edge represents the mathematical advantage that the casino holds over the player in the long run. For example:

    • A slot game may have a house edge of 3%–10%.
    • Roulette may carry around 2.7% on certain versions.
    • Blackjack, when played optimally, can have a lower house edge.

    The key phrase here is “in the long run.” This means that over thousands or millions of rounds, the casino statistically earns a small percentage of total wagers. However, short-term outcomes can vary significantly. Players may win or lose depending on chance, strategy, and timing.

    Why Many Players Feel They Always Lose

    The belief that online casino play only results in loss often comes from psychological and behavioral factors.

    Emotional Decision-Making

    When players experience losses, emotions such as frustration or urgency can lead to chasing losses. This means increasing bet sizes in an attempt to recover previous money. Statistically, this increases risk rather than improving odds.

    Misunderstanding Probability

    Many players misunderstand how probability works. For example, after several losses in a row, someone might believe a win is “due.” This is known as the gambler’s fallacy. In reality, each round is independent. The system does not compensate for previous losses.

    High-Risk Betting Habits

    Some individuals play with money they cannot afford to lose. When gambling shifts from entertainment to financial expectation, disappointment becomes more intense.
